Questions & Answers
Q: How does disobeying Allah affect our relationship with angels as mentioned in the content?
Disobeying Allah drives away angels who are appointed to support and protect us. It impacts our emotions, relationships, and worldly success.
Q: What influence do angels and Satan have on individuals according to the Prophet's narrations?
Angels promise good and affirm truth, while Satan promises evil and denies truth. It's crucial to discern and follow the guidance of angels.
Q: How can individuals optimize their lives to benefit from allies and protect themselves from enemies?
Being mindful of false promises from Satan and engaging in sincere repentance can help individuals strengthen their bond with Allah and allies.
Q: What is the significance of seeking refuge in Allah from Satan, as advised by the Prophet?
Seeking refuge in Allah safeguards individuals from the harmful influence of Satan and helps in resisting temptations that lead to disobedience.
